INSIGHT

Palantir Succeeds By Gluing Data And Placing Engineers

  • Palantir sells Foundry as a powerful data-integration platform that merges many government and commercial sources for search and analysis.
  • The value comes less from novel algorithms and more from combining disparate feeds and expert forward-deployed engineers who embed with clients.
INSIGHT

Immigration OS Is A Multifunction Deportation Ecosystem

  • Immigration OS is an ICE-focused ecosystem Palantir is building to track self-deportations, prioritize targets, and streamline deportation logistics.
  • It started with CBP Home self-deportation tracking and expanded into broader targeting and logistics tools for ICE and DHS.
INSIGHT

Adding IRS And SSA Data Would Deeply Expand Surveillance

  • Palantir-enabled databases ingest DHS, USCIS and other federal sources and seek to add IRS and SSA data to improve address and identity matching.
  • Using IRS/SSA data for immigration tracking is highly sensitive and runs into privacy rules and recent erroneous IRS disclosures.
